Warning: Can't synchronize with repository "(default)" (/home/git/ome.git does not appear to be a Git repository.). Look in the Trac log for more information.
Notice: In order to edit this ticket you need to be either: a Product Owner, The owner or the reporter of the ticket, or, in case of a Task not yet assigned, a team_member"

Task #8443 (closed)

Opened 12 years ago

Closed 12 years ago

Last modified 12 years ago

Anon user ROOT

Reported by: wmoore Owned by: cxallan
Priority: major Milestone: OMERO-4.4
Component: Web Version: n.a.
Keywords: n.a. Cc: atarkowska, saloynton, rkferguson
Resources: n.a. Referenced By: n.a.
References: n.a. Remaining Time: 0.0d
Sprint: 2012-04-24 (13)

Description

Is the anonymous user 'ROOT' settings parameter used anywhere to limit the scope of urls that support anonymous user login?

Currently this doesn't appear to be implemented in the decorators etc.

Change History (6)

comment:1 Changed 12 years ago by cxallan

  • Remaining Time set to 0.5
  • Status changed from new to accepted

comment:2 Changed 12 years ago by cxallan

  • Sprint changed from 2012-04-10 (12) to 2012-04-24 (13)

comment:3 Changed 12 years ago by cxallan

  • Remaining Time changed from 0.5 to 0
  • Resolution set to fixed
  • Status changed from accepted to closed

URL filtering is now available on the 8118_share_connection branch. Closing.

comment:4 Changed 12 years ago by Chris Allan <callan@…>

(In [2ae66f8d1189eabef9273b6f52e33539916cce9f/ome.git] on branch develop) Reorganised and expanded public user interaction. (See #8443, #8483)

There is now an additional 'omero.web.public.server_id' configuration
option which allows the system administrator to configure the desired
OMERO.server instance to use anonymous / public authentication with.
Furthermore this commit moves the connection retrieval logic into a two
stage process where the retrieval of an "authenticated" connection is
attempted first and if that fails or credentials are missing a "public"
connection attempt is then made.

comment:5 Changed 12 years ago by Aleksandra Tarkowska <A.Tarkowska@…>

(In [14ee811842b60eb6e39130c7dd150fbd16abf02e/ome.git] on branch develop) Reorganised and expanded public user interaction. (See #8443, #8483)

There is now an additional 'omero.web.public.server_id' configuration
option which allows the system administrator to configure the desired
OMERO.server instance to use anonymous / public authentication with.
Furthermore this commit moves the connection retrieval logic into a two
stage process where the retrieval of an "authenticated" connection is
attempted first and if that fails or credentials are missing a "public"
connection attempt is then made.

comment:6 Changed 12 years ago by Aleksandra Tarkowska <A.Tarkowska@…>

(In [f1f31d9b588e063b01d4272e22f6c19b6a45b9a6/ome.git] on branch develop) Initial version of OMERO.webpublic URL filtering. (See #8443)

The unimplemented omero.web.public.root configuration option has now
been superceded by a regular expression based conditional filter called
omero.web.public.filter. This allows the server administrator to be
much more selective about the URLs that he or she wants to expose via
the OMERO.webpublic anonymous login infrastructure. The current default
is ^/(?!webadmin) and its intention is to allow access to all URLs bar
those of the administration interface.

Note: See TracTickets for help on using tickets. You may also have a look at Agilo extensions to the ticket.

1.3.13-PRO © 2008-2011 Agilo Software all rights reserved (this page was served in: 0.67808 sec.)

We're Hiring!